The fee for pursuing a B.E./B.Tech course at SSBT's College of Engineering and Technology, Jalgaon is different for each course and the mode of admission. For students seeking admission in government quota seats, the charges for tuition fees are generally in the region of INR 70,000 per annum. Since private quota fees are expected to be much higher, these may be pegged approximately at about INR 1,20,000 in a year. These figures are subject to annual changes to a small extent, therefore, it is prudent to refer to the college's website or contact the college for the latest precise and reliable fees structure.

At Asan Memorial College of Engineering and Technology, the annual cost of the B.E/B.Tech programs ranges from about 55000 to 75000. The precise cost is determined by the engineering specialisation selected and whether the applicant is accepted under the management quota or the government quota (TNEA). There may be additional fees for things like exam fees lodging fees and other amenities. For qualified applicants scholarships and tuition reductions are offered especially to those from economically disadvantaged backgrounds or with exceptional academic records.?
